Lung cancer accounts for more deaths per year than any other form of cancer, resulting in a total of 158,000 deaths per year in the U.S. Non-small cell lung cancer (NSCLC) is diagnosed in greater than 224,000 Americans every year. Methylation and subsequent downregulation of certain genes has been directly linked to the uncontrolled growth of NSCLC cells. Natural killer (NK) cells are key innate immune cells responsible for apoptosis of cells with incorrect genetic code. Droughts are now a common occurrence in Southern California and are known to cause population declines in many species, and such bottlenecks can cause a loss of genetic variation. Genetic variation was examined in a population of the California newt located in Arroyo Sequit Creek in the Santa Monica Mountains. Genetic data from animals examined prior to the current drought were compared to similar data collected from the population after it experienced several years of severe drought. Proper taxonomic and molecular study is necessary to better organize closely related species that may not only be used for human needs, but also in the quest for knowledge of how the world around us works. Though important, the taxonomic placement of Nebraskan and Iowan bird’s nest fungi (Nidulariaceae) is not well documented. Here, phylogenetic analysis is used to place the Nidulariaceae of Nebraska and Iowa in the tree of life using molecular and morphological techniques.
